How to Plan the Perfect Solo Date in 2025
Planning a solo date is all about intention and mindfulness. Here are some tips to make your solo date memorable and meaningful:
- Set a Clear Intention: Decide what you want from your solo date. Is it relaxation, adventure, creativity, or reflection? Your intention will guide your choice of activity.
- Choose a Time and Place: Block out a specific time in your schedule, just as you would for a date with someone else. Pick a location that feels special, whether it’s your cozy living room or a new spot in town.
- Dress the Part: Wear something that makes you feel confident and happy. Even if you’re staying in, dressing up can elevate the experience.
- Unplug When Possible: Disconnect from social media and notifications to fully immerse yourself in the moment.
- Budget Wisely: Solo dates don’t have to be expensive. Many of the ideas below are free or low-cost, making self-love accessible to everyone.
- Reflect Afterward: Journal about your experience or simply take a moment to appreciate how it made you feel.

25. Try Geocaching
Geocaching is a real-world treasure hunt using GPS coordinates. Download the Geocaching app, find a cache near you, and embark on a solo adventure to locate it. It’s like a modern-day scavenger hunt.
Why It’s Great: It’s a fun, low-cost way to explore new places.

Common Questions About Solo Dating
Is it weird to go on a solo date?
Not at all! Solo dates are a normal and healthy way to practice self-care. They’re about enjoying your own company and prioritizing your happiness.
What if I feel self-conscious doing things alone?
Start with low-pressure activities, like a coffee shop visit or a walk in the park. Over time, you’ll build confidence and realize most people are too focused on themselves to notice.
How often should I go on solo dates?
It depends on your schedule and needs. Aim for at least one solo date a month to maintain a strong connection with yourself.
Can I go on solo dates if I’m in a relationship?
Absolutely! Solo dates are about self-love, not replacing your partner. They can even strengthen your relationship by fostering independence.
